Welcome to Intervention 911
There is no place for blame,
judgment, criticism, or anger in a drug or alcohol intervention.
We know that "ambush" style interventions do not work.
The remarkable success rates of our intervention
specialists are the result of our well-grounded belief/philosophy
that the only way to reach and addict and permeate their unrelenting
denial is through compassion, love and overwhelming support
by those who are most important to them.
Our intervention
specialists are some of the best and most compassionate
in the industry. We have a 98% success rate in getting addicts
into our highly effective treatment
